I am a media specialist in a 5-8 building. We are not automated. This will be my third year. The card catalog is a disaster area. For the last year, I have been working on just matching up shelf list cards with books that are actually on the shelf and weeding. One of our 6th grade teachers wants her students to check out adventure stories on Friday. I am not sure they have been cataloged with such a subheading so feel it would be difficult to direct students to where they could be found. Can any of you suggest specific authors which I could then compare with the card catalog and make some suggestions to the students when they come in? Thanks in advance for your help.
